What Should You Look For in a Bartonville Newborn Photographer?

Finding the right Newborn Photographer Bartonville is about more than finding the photographer with the prettiest Instagram feed. Newborn photography combines artistic skill with patience, preparation, communication, and an understanding of how to work around a baby’s unpredictable schedule.

Start with the photographer’s newborn portfolio. Look at the consistency of the images rather than judging the photographer based on one spectacular photograph. Do you like the lighting? Are the skin tones natural? Do the photographs feel warm and emotional? Are the poses gentle? Do the parents and siblings look comfortable?

Then consider the photographer’s approach to newborn safety. This is particularly important when posed newborn photography is involved. Ask how the photographer handles babies who are unsettled, how feeding breaks are handled, and what happens if your baby simply does not cooperate with a particular pose.

A good photographer should understand that the baby’s comfort comes first.

How Much Does Newborn Photography Cost?

There is no single price for newborn photography in Bartonville.

The final investment can depend on the photographer’s experience, session length, number of photographs, studio environment, included products, digital files, prints, albums, and artwork.

Some photographers offer an all-inclusive package. Others separate the session fee from digital images or printed artwork.

Jamie Denholm Photography, for example, currently lists lifestyle newborn sessions starting at $750 plus tax and a lifestyle-and-posed newborn session at $800 plus tax, with additional offerings and conditions detailed on its investment page.

White Lavender Photography follows a different luxury model, with a $300 in-studio newborn booking fee and artwork purchased separately.

This difference demonstrates why simply comparing the advertised session fee can be misleading. Always ask what you actually receive for the money.

What Questions Should You Ask Before Booking?

Before choosing your Newborn Photographer Bartonville, have a short conversation with your favorite photographers.

Ask how many newborn sessions they photograph, where sessions take place, what is included, whether parents and siblings can participate, how long the session usually takes, and how the final images are delivered.

Ask about turnaround time as well. If you need photographs for birth announcements, gifts, or a particular event, you will want to know when your final gallery will be ready.

You should also ask about rescheduling. Babies don’t always follow the schedule we planned during pregnancy. Understanding the photographer’s policies before signing a contract can prevent stress later.

Most importantly, look for someone you feel comfortable with.
